tomcat 端口被占用 解决方案

来源:互联网 发布:国外域名注册商 编辑:程序博客网 时间:2024/04/28 05:28

1、查看占用某端口的进程

例如:tomcat以外关闭,但进程还在,此时启动会报错,端口被占用,这样找到这个占用端口的进程,然后干掉即可。

netstat -ano|findstr 8080

这个进程的 PID 就是 996了。

启动任务管理器 Ctrl+Alt+Delete

选 “查看“  -->  ”选择列"  -->  PID(进程标识符) 勾选

这样就能看到此时的进程 ID了

找到PID 为996 的进程,一般都是 javaw.exe  然后干掉,在启动tomact即可

注意:如果不是这个进程占用tomcat的端口,那就需要看看当前占用tomcat端口的进程是什么了,在决定要不要停止进程。

如果不能停止进程的话,就更改tomcat的端口把。

在tomcat根目录/conf/server.xml 中有个

<Service name="Catalina">

之后的第一个 <Connector port="8080" ...的配置 改掉就好  我是电脑有俩tomcat 这个就改成了8090

访问的时候别忘记更改端口好就好。

http://127.0.0.1:8090/...


都是从菜鸟过来的。。。以上是个人总结,希望会对大家有所帮助~~  o(∩_∩)o 哈哈